About us... Nestled on the Greenwich Peninsula, attached to the O2, InterContinental London - The O2 embraces a captivating backdrop of the River Thames and Canary Wharf. Our five-star hotel includes 493 bedrooms, a diverse dining selection, spa facilities, state-of-the-art conference and meeting rooms, including the UK's largest pillar-free ballroom.
A bit about what you will do... Shift Engineers in our team provide effective repair and preventative maintenance to ensure our hotel, grounds and facilities are kept in excellent condition. Maintain the building and grounds to the highest standard, without compromising the guest experience. Complete day-to-day maintenance requests. Ensure that all fixtures and fittings are maintained in perfect working condition and any defects are corrected promptly. Complete regular machinery testing and maintenance on the hotel machines and equipment. Responding to maintenance emergency calls from all departments.
